The Political Economy of Science Technology and Innovation.

book
posted on 2023-06-07, 21:03 authored by Ben MartinBen Martin, Paul NightingalePaul Nightingale
A collection of papers by leading scholars on the role of scientific and technological innovation in modern industry. Topics covered include the historical roots of the subject, the function of science in technological innovation and economic growth, and the climate for innovation in industry.
